Gå til innhold

Klarer ikke lese session


Anbefalte innlegg

skal lage innlogging og sessions blir satt, men på scriptet som skal inkluderes for å sjekke om du er innlogget så klarer det ikke å lese sessions

<?php
ob_start();

$in_script=true;
include "../config.php";
$brukernavn = mysql_real_escape_string($_POST['brukernavn']);
$passord = (mysql_real_escape_string($_POST['passord']));

$spmlogin = mysql_query("SELECT * from `brukere` WHERE `brukernavn`='$brukernavn' AND `passord`='$passord'") or die(mysql_error());

if(mysql_num_rows($spmlogin)==1){
 //Riktig passord
 echo "Riktig passord";
 $_SESSION['login']=true;
 $_SESSION['brukernavn']=$brukernavn;
 $_SESSION['passord']=$passord;
 
 //header("LOCATION: index.php");
}
else{
 //Feil passord
 echo "Feil passord";
}

ob_flush();


?>

Det er koden som setter session

 

<?php
session_start();

$in_script=true;
include "../config.php";

echo $_SESSION['login'];
echo $_SESSION['brukernavn'];
//sjekk brukernavn og passord
$spm=mysql_query("SELECT * from `brukere` WHERE `brukernavn` = '$_SESSION[brukernavn]' AND `passord`='$_SESSION[passord]'") or die(mysql_error());
echo mysql_num_rows($spm);
if(mysql_num_rows($spm)==1){
 //riktig passord
 $login=true;
 echo "innlogga";
}
else{
 $login = false;
 echo "faen";
}




?>

denne sjekker om du er innlogga, men klarer ikke lese sessions verdiene

Lenke til kommentar
Videoannonse
Annonse

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
×
×
  • Opprett ny...